Fibroblast Growth Factor 21 Exerts its Anti‐inflammatory Effects on Multiple Cell Types of Adipose Tissue in Obesity

Abstract: Objective Obesity‐related, chronic, low‐grade inflammation has been identified as a key factor in the development of many metabolic diseases, such as type 2 diabetes and cardiovascular diseases. Adipocytes, preadipocytes, and macrophages have been implicated in initiating inflammation in adipose tissue. This study aims to investigate the effects of fibroblast growth factor‐21 (FGF‐21) on obesity‐related inflammation and its mechanisms in vivo and in vitro. “…517 FGF21 has anti-inflammatory effect on preadipocytes via FRS2/ ERK1/2 signaling pathway. 518 Besides, FGF21 can suppress the production of IL-1β mediated by NLRP3 (NOD-, LRR-and pyrin domain-containing protein 3) inflammasome. 519 In general, inflammation increases the expression of FGF21, which is an anti-inflammatory factor in many diseases.…”
